9 East 96th Street
is a Co-op
located 9 East 96th Street, in East Harlem, New York.
The building was first built in 1926 and is 98 years old.
The lot that the building was built on is 73 feet wide and 101 feet long.
The official lot area is listed as 7,317 square feet.
The building itself is 72 feet wide and 80 feet long.
In total, 9 East 96th Street has a total floor area of 73,125 square feet.
Of that, 72,150 square feet are used for residential purposes.
About 975 square feet of the building are used for commercial purposes.
There are a total of 48 units. Of those, 47 are residential units.
There is one commercial unit.
9 East 96th Street has a total of 16 floors.
